After <a href=\"https:\/\/twitter.com\/blur_io\/status\/1616125798951571456\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">delaying the launch<\/a> of the platform\u2019s native token in January, the NFT marketplace officially began letting users redeem care packages for the token at 1:30 p.m. ET on February 14, 2023. The run-up to the launch has been marked by much anticipation, with popular exchange <a href=\"https:\/\/twitter.com\/CoinbaseAssets\/status\/1625175458936504345\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Coinbase tweeting<\/a> that it would list the token if liquidity conditions are met and <a href=\"https:\/\/dappradar.com\/blog\/new-dapps-report-blur-nft-trading-volume-spikes\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Blur\u2019s trading volume<\/a> surging in the last month, cementing its spot as one of the top ten NFT marketplaces in existence.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>How did Blur manage to do all of this in such a short time? Founded by Web3 dev <a href=\"https:\/\/twitter.com\/PacmanBlur\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Pacman<\/a> and launched in October 2022, the low-fee, <a href=\"https:\/\/nftnow.com\/features\/heres-where-the-top-nft-marketplaces-stand-on-creator-royalties\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">royalties-optional marketplace<\/a> has seen over <a href=\"https:\/\/dappradar.com\/ethereum\/marketplaces\/blur\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">$430 million in trading volume<\/a> in the last 30 days. That number is especially impressive given that Blur\u2019s collective trading volume amounted to <a href=\"https:\/\/dappradar.com\/blog\/new-dapps-report-blur-nft-trading-volume-spikes\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">over $301 million<\/a> between its launch in October 2022 to the end of December.<\/p>\n<p>The marketplace\u2019s success is the result of its strategy to target a specific demographic of Web3 user: the pro trader. Where platforms like OpenSea or Objkt appeal more to more casual NFT enthusiasts engaging in smaller trades on an occasional basis, Blur is meant to hook those who engage in high-volume trades with reasonable frequency. The marketplace\u2019s stance on royalties, which has generally been to keep them as low as possible and allow traders the option to enforce them or not, speaks to this approach. This is also why, while Web3 giant OpenSea consistently has more <a href=\"https:\/\/dune.com\/queries\/598264\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">daily active users<\/a>, Blur rivals and <a href=\"https:\/\/dappradar.com\/multichain\/marketplaces\/opensea\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">occasionally surpasses<\/a> the platform in trading volume.\u00a0<\/p>\n<h2>What is $BLUR?<\/h2>\n<p>$BLUR is Blur\u2019s long-awaited native token. It\u2019s an ERC-20 governance token that will have <a href=\"https:\/\/etherscan.io\/token\/0x5283d291dbcf85356a21ba090e6db59121208b44\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">a maximum supply<\/a> of three billion. Twelve percent of that supply is <a href=\"https:\/\/twitter.com\/0xCygaar\/status\/1625540477264220161\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">allocated to airdrop holders<\/a>, with another 78 percent delegated to two lock-up contracts and nine percent owned by a multi-sig wallet controlled by the Blur team. The earliest information out of <a href=\"https:\/\/coinmarketcap.com\/currencies\/blur-token\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">CoinMarketCap<\/a> put the token\u2019s fully-diluted market cap at $14 billion, with a single $BLUR token currently being traded for just shy of $5.00, but the most recent figures drop both of those sharply to just under $2.5 billion and $0.69. <\/p>\n<p>Users have been collecting $BLUR in the form of airdrops from the platform over the last few months. The <a href=\"https:\/\/mirror.xyz\/blurdao.eth\/2nba-2j0zHPrBX0iPSNGquZ9s_WotNH6B4e5usz85mM\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">first airdrop<\/a> rewarded those who \u201cstuck around in the bear market,\u201d i.e., anyone who traded NFTs on Ethereum in the six months before Blur\u2019s October launch. The second consisted of <a href=\"https:\/\/mirror.xyz\/blurdao.eth\/XgvGOFLwdxpdRIF2BRsQqngvcBw5WMuDOcwUK3KR1AE\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">$BLUR care packages<\/a> for platform users who listed NFTs on Blur (after meeting a certain threshold) from October 19 to December 5. The third was aimed at traders who placed bids on Blur and was the <a href=\"https:\/\/mirror.xyz\/blurdao.eth\/BnVAt_z_6bEr9O4oLIFwyEjCmAGGb02jz8y3G7qJQhA\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">largest of the three airdrops<\/a>. Active <a href=\"https:\/\/twitter.com\/franklinisbored\/status\/1625204931526332444\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">users who kept up with this system<\/a> have greatly anticipated the launch of the token.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>Pacman has said that Blur has done its best to <a href=\"https:\/\/youtu.be\/bHGHZyBEPvM\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">avoid incentivizing volume<\/a> as a Web3 platform, as this encourages wash trading, resulting in distorted metrics and a lower-quality product to offer its user base. Having incentivized liquidity instead via its second airdrop by rewarding users who listed NFTs on its platform (and giving no reward to users for the actual <em>sale<\/em> of those NFTs), they removed the wash-trading payoff. And with Blur\u2019s third, bid-focused airdrop, the marketplace did much the same, especially by providing greater rewards to bids that were closer to floor prices and better reflected the actual market price of those NFTs.\u00a0<\/p>\n<h2 id=\"h-blur-utility\">$BLUR utility<\/h2>\n<p>$BLUR will be used as the marketplace\u2019s governance token, allowing the platform to edge its way toward a more decentralized future. Blur is also taking a unique approach to the royalties debate with its token dynamics, as platform users who choose to uphold creator royalties are rewarded with more of the token.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>Web3 will have to wait to see how Blur\u2019s users react to the launch of the $BLUR token. Nansen, a Web3 analytics firm, recently highlighted how <a href=\"https:\/\/twitter.com\/nansen_ai\/status\/1625523410494423040\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">LooksRare users responded<\/a> to that platform\u2019s native token when it launched, noting that most holders either sold, transferred, or staked their token.\u00a0For now, users should stay diligent to avoid malicious actors trying to siphon their tokens, as keen observers have noticed <a href=\"https:\/\/twitter.com\/0xCygaar\/status\/1625345646625710081\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">fake Blur token contracts<\/a> being deployed to fool platform users who aren\u2019t careful.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>Token launches <a href=\"https:\/\/nftnow.com\/news\/bayc-official-apecoin-token-launch\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">can do wonders for Web3<\/a> entities, but they must be properly navigated. For all Blur\u2019s recent success, it doesn\u2019t have the pedigree of an NFT mainstay like the Bored Ape Yacht Club. How its community responds to the launch (and what utility and value it brings them) is likely to have a massive impact on the future of the up-and-coming marketplace juggernaut.
